本文目录导读:
在当今这个高度依赖互联网的时代,服务器的稳定性和安全性对于企业和个人用户来说至关重要,尽管我们已经采取了各种措施来确保服务器的正常运行,但服务器崩溃仍然是一个不可避免的问题,本文将探讨服务器崩溃的原因、影响以及解决方案。
服务器崩溃的原因
1、硬件故障:服务器是由众多硬件组件组成的,包括CPU、内存、硬盘、电源等,这些硬件组件在长时间运行过程中可能会出现故障,导致服务器崩溃。
2、软件问题:服务器运行的软件可能存在bug或者兼容性问题,这些问题可能会导致服务器崩溃。
3、系统资源不足:当服务器承载的负载超过其处理能力时,可能会导致系统资源不足,从而引发服务器崩溃。
4、网络攻击:服务器可能会遭受到来自黑客的网络攻击,如DDoS攻击、病毒攻击等,这些攻击可能会导致服务器崩溃。
5、自然灾害:地震、洪水等自然灾害可能会导致服务器所在机房的设备损坏,进而引发服务器崩溃。
服务器崩溃的影响
1、数据丢失:服务器崩溃可能导致数据丢失,这对于企业和个人用户来说都是一个沉重的打击,数据丢失可能包括用户数据、网站数据、数据库数据等。
2、业务中断:服务器崩溃会导致网站、应用程序等无法正常运行,这将直接影响到企业的业务和收入。
3、信誉损失:服务器崩溃可能导致用户无法正常使用服务,这将影响到企业的信誉和品牌形象。
4、法律风险:如果服务器崩溃导致用户数据丢失,企业可能需要承担法律责任,如赔偿损失等。
服务器崩溃的解决方案
1、定期检查和维护:定期对服务器进行检查和维护,确保硬件设备正常运行,及时发现并解决潜在问题。
2、升级硬件:根据服务器的实际负载情况,适时升级硬件设备,提高服务器的处理能力。
3、优化软件:对服务器运行的软件进行优化,修复bug,提高软件的稳定性和兼容性。
4、监控系统资源:实时监控系统资源使用情况,合理分配资源,确保服务器在高负载情况下仍能稳定运行。
5、加强安全防护:部署防火墙、安全软件等,提高服务器的安全防护能力,防止网络攻击导致的服务器崩溃。
6、备份数据:定期备份服务器数据,确保数据安全,在服务器崩溃时,可以通过备份数据尽快恢复服务。
7、选择合适的托管服务商:选择有良好口碑和实力的托管服务商,确保服务器所在的机房具备稳定的电力供应、良好的网络环境和安全保障。
服务器崩溃是一个复杂的问题,需要我们从多个方面进行预防和应对,通过定期检查和维护、升级硬件、优化软件、监控系统资源、加强安全防护、备份数据以及选择合适的托管服务商等措施,我们可以降低服务器崩溃的风险,确保服务器的稳定运行。
案例分析
为了更好地理解服务器崩溃的原因、影响和解决方案,下面我们来看一个实际的案例。
某电商公司在其双十一期间,由于访问量激增,服务器承受了巨大的压力,最终导致了服务器崩溃,这次服务器崩溃导致了以下影响:
1、用户无法正常访问网站,购物体验受到影响,导致部分用户流失。
2、订单系统无法正常运行,部分用户的订单信息丢失,给公司带来了经济损失。
3、网站崩溃的消息迅速传播,影响了公司的信誉和品牌形象。
针对这次服务器崩溃,公司采取了以下解决方案:
1、立即启动应急预案,尽快恢复服务器运行。
2、对服务器进行深入检查,发现并解决了一些潜在的硬件和软件问题。
3、加大服务器硬件设备的投入,提高了服务器的处理能力。
4、优化了网站的架构,提高了服务器的承载能力。
5、加强了安全防护,提高了服务器抵御网络攻击的能力。
通过以上措施,公司成功解决了服务器崩溃的问题,并在后续的运营中避免了类似问题的再次发生。
服务器崩溃是一个严重的问题,需要我们从多个方面进行预防和应对,通过了解服务器崩溃的原因、影响以及解决方案,我们可以更好地保障服务器的稳定运行,为企业和个人用户提供优质的服务,我们也要认识到,服务器崩溃并非绝对不可避免,只要我们采取有效的措施,就能降低服务器崩溃的风险,确保服务器的稳定运行。